What are some other ways to incorporate the "word of the day" into your life?

This is a question that often arises. There are numerous ways to utilize a word of the day and make it a regular part of your routine.

  • Journaling: Write a sentence or paragraph about how the word of the day relates to your experiences, feelings, or observations.
  • Creative Writing: Use the word in a short story, poem, or song.
  • Conversation: Try to incorporate the word into a conversation with friends or family.
  • Visual Representation: Create a visual representation of the word, either through drawing or photography.

By engaging with the word on multiple levels, you deepen your understanding and appreciation for its nuances.
